Doctors Restore 83% of Man’s Skull with 3D Printing and Titanium Implants

In a groundbreaking medical achievement, doctors have successfully restored 83% of a man’s skull using a combination of 3D printing technology and titanium implants. The remarkable procedure, which has been described as one of the most extensive cranial reconstructions ever performed, offers new hope for patients suffering from severe head injuries.

The patient, whose identity has not been disclosed for privacy reasons, sustained devastating skull damage following a traumatic accident. Traditional surgical methods would have been unable to fully restore the structure and protection needed for his brain. However, advancements in 3D printing allowed surgeons to create a customized implant that fit his skull with remarkable precision.

Using detailed imaging scans, doctors mapped the patient’s cranial structure and produced a titanium framework that could replace the missing bone. The implant was designed layer by layer with 3D printing technology, ensuring both durability and compatibility with the patient’s anatomy. Once implanted, it provided critical protection while also restoring the natural shape of the head.

Medical experts say this case represents a leap forward in reconstructive surgery. Titanium, known for its strength and resistance to corrosion, has long been used in medical implants. When paired with the precision of 3D printing, it opens the door to highly personalized treatments that were previously impossible.

Following the surgery, doctors reported that the patient is recovering well, regaining mobility and confidence. The procedure not only improved his physical safety but also had a profound emotional impact. For many patients, cranial injuries can affect self-image and quality of life, making successful reconstruction life-changing.

This milestone highlights how technology is reshaping medicine. From prosthetics to organ research, 3D printing is revolutionizing the way doctors treat complex conditions. Experts believe that such techniques could soon become standard for patients with severe bone damage, offering faster recovery times and better outcomes.
